For the first time in my life, things finally came up Gary. I have been a pretty big nerd for a long time, and by nerd, I mean a sports nerd. Fantasy sports have been a big part of my life for over ten years now, and although my free online Fantasy Locker with Yahoo is packed with trophies, whenever money is involved, I lose. I don't know if it's Karma, pressure, or just bad luck, but for whatever reason, once I have something to gain besides pride, it's all over, might as well just donate the money to someone who actually needs it, (unlike the boozehound degenerates that I slum around with).

So you can imagine my excitement when I got the phone call yesterday from my boy Pistol Pete, "Hey, I am just gonna drop off the money today after work?" "Seriously, I won?????" "Yep." Just like that, I hung up the phone, and a new chapter of my life began. I always said I could die a happy man once I ended this horendous streak, and I truley feel like I can leave this world tomorrow, with a smile on my face.

How did this all happen? To quote one of my idols Happy Gilmore, "Some people call it luck, but I call it.......... well luck I guess. So What?!"  I entered two Playoff Hockey Drafts this year, the illustrious Mazzei Draft, and the not so famous Trumpy Draft. I went in to both with a gameplan, that plan was take the Blackhawks, anyone I could grab, because I had a feeling, then sprinkle on a bit of Bruins, since I love them. Then, before I knew it, things started coming together, both teams were winning, and so was I.

It's crazy how the Fantasy Sports world has changed people. The hardcores go from being huge fans of their teams, to huge fans of whoever they ended up with in their draft, totally forgetting about their lifelong allegiance to said favorite team.

I always told myself that I would never fall victim to the "cheer against your team" syndrom that seems to have broken out like that virus in the movie Outbreak (I never looked at Monkeys the same way after that movie) . Staying true to myself, I have always drafted Bruins, and this year was no different, but, this time, I used my head to mix them into two winning teams.

Come to think of it, I probably would have been able to afford more than three month old Hamburger Helper, KD, and on the good days, KD with No Name brand wieners chopped into it, if I would have not always bet on the Arizona Cardinals, Toronto Blue Jays, Boston Bruins, and the Toronto Raptors.

I guess it's like Steve Morari always says, " When it rains, it pours."

I know what you all are thinking right now  "But Gary, what am I supposed to take away from all this, what is the moral of this story???" The moral is this, it's always more fun to gamble, when gambling on teams and players you cheer for. Sure I can take A-rod or anyone on the Montreal Canadien's roster, but when the guys/teams you like are winning, AND they make you some cash, that my friends, to quote this guy  "Is Perfect!".

The Maestro of Bloganomics, wanted me to touch on the Pete Rose argument. Gambling on your favorite team is like gambling on yourself, it will make you feel better at the time, but it will never get you into the sports gambling hall of fame.
